45 Million Dinars Were Wasted During Corona

02 November 2020 Coronavirus

After expressing an opinion on 1531 issues, worth 1.9 billion dinars, during the period from the first of April until the end of last October, the period that witnessed the spread of the Corona crisis, the Audit Bureau revealed that it is the most dangerous entity in the country to violate the law in 13 topics, through contracts It results in the disbursement of sums of public funds, or the possibility of disbursing them, unlawfully, in a waste of 45 million dinars.

In a statement yesterday, the assistant auditor at the Department of Pre-Supervision of Economic Affairs at the Bureau, Shahd Al-Munais, said that its department notified the Bureau's Violations Department that some bodies had completed special engagements with 28 issues, worth 63 million dinars, before obtaining the Bureau's approval.

 

Al-Munis added that “Accounting” rejected 77 articles with 230 million, after its contractual procedures were found to be incorrect, explaining that the highest percentage of those rejected subjects were for the Ministry of Health, with 40 topics, valued at 142 million, and workers were refused for the security and safety of the oil sector complex. And the Petroleum Training Center, with a value of 2.5 million, belongs to the Kuwait Petroleum Corporation for several reasons.

She pointed out that the "accounting" returned the papers of 491 subjects, representing 32% of what was presented to him, for not providing him with the necessary papers and documents, and related documents, data and clarifications, adding that prior monitoring provided the public treasury during the past fiscal year about 52 million dinars.

She stated that the Bureau approved 64% of the total issues presented to it, with a value of 1.2 billion dinars, noting that this approval came after verifying the validity of the contracting procedures carried out by the concerned authorities, "and the subsequent supervision will follow up on their scrutiny."
